    Tamia Hill (born Tamia Marylin Washington May 9, 1975), professionally known as Tamia, is a Canadian-American Grammy nominated R&B singer. Biography Early years Tamia was born in Windsor, Ontario, Canada. Despite having a start in the traditional gospel choir, she first only aspired to be a vocal coach, but during a trip to Los Angeles, her voice caught the attention of producer Quincy Jones at a 1994 awards show after party. In 1994, at the age of nineteen, Tamia recorded vocals for a Quincy Jones' song "You Put a Move on My Heart" from his Q's Jook Joint album. Jones released the song as a single in 1995, and it was nominated for a Grammy Award. Later that year, Tamia participated in another collaboration, "Missing You", a single from the Set It Off soundtrack that also featured singers Brandy, Chaka Khan, and Gladys Knight.
